Job description

Overview

As a Qualified Medication Aide (QMA), you'll play a crucial role in assisting with medication administration, inventory management, and the safe storage of pharmaceutical items. Working under close supervision, you'll ensure adherence to protocols and procedures while maintaining accurate records. Your attention to detail and commitment to patient safety will be paramount in supporting the healthcare team's efforts in delivering quality care.


Responsibilities

  • Prepare and administer prescribed medications under RN supervision, ensuring compliance with Facility policies, Pharmacy Board regulations, and safety principles.
  • Document medication administration accurately on the Medication Administration Record (MAR), including any medications not administered and reasons for non-administration.
  • Adhere to infection control techniques, incorporate universal precautions, and uphold the six rights of medication administration.
  • Participate in data collection, medication audits, and performance improvement activities, promptly reporting adverse reactions to supervisors.
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the medication cart, reorder and replace medications and supplies as needed, and uphold patient confidentiality and HIPAA regulations.

Qualifications

Education

  • High School graduate or equivalent.

Experience

  • One (1) year related experience in a medical environment preferred.
  • Completed QMAP training and passed competency evaluation in accordance with program requirements.

Licenses/Certifications

  • Must have current CPR Certification and provide QMAP ID number for online verification.
